Pandi, Milly, Kate. The Gloria Darlings are a Seattle-based female folk-grass trio. An innovative string band like nothing ever seen or heard, they sing bright, vibrant, vocal harmonies to outstanding instrumentation. These young ladies are all multi-instrumentalists: fiddle, guitar, banjo, mountain dulcimer. Often-called sirens, their catchy original tunes weave through the crowd. Definitely a band to watch; the tour de force harmony get every crowd smiling, singing along and toe tapping.

Their deep well of repertoire is full of original tunes, traditionals, and folksy renditions of popular song. Influences include Joni Mitchell, The Carter Family, Phil Ochs and Madonna. The Gloria Darlings appear frequently at folk festivals and venues from Eugene to Bellingham, sing backups for Northwest folk legend Linda Waterfall, and can frequently be found at the center of the universe, Seattle’s Pike Place Market.
